/*Theme Name: Single Page IIITheme URI:  http://Description: Custom Minimal WordPress ThemeVersion: 1.0Author: Burghaus MediaAuthor URI: http://*//*andy meyer's reset and blueprint defaults*/html,body,div,span,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,code,del,dfn,em,img,q,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td{	margin:0;	padding:0;	border:0;	font-weight:inherit;	font-style:inherit;	font-size:100%;	font-family:inherit;	vertical-align:baseline	}a img{border:none}body{	font-size:100%;	color:#A8A498;	background:#F8F8F8;	font-family: helvetica, arial, sans-serif;	line-height:1.5em	}h1,h2,h3,h4,h5,h6{	font-weight:normal;	color:#765D1A;	font-family: 'bauer bodoni LT', bodoni, cambria, georgia, serif;	}h1{	font-size:3em;	line-height:1em;	margin-bottom:0.5em	}h2{	font-size:2em;	margin-bottom:0.75em	}h3{	font-size:1.5em;	line-height:1;	margin-bottom:1em	}h4{	font-size:1.2em;	line-height:1.25;	margin-bottom:1.25em	}h5{	font-size:1em;	font-weight:bold;	margin-bottom:1.5em	}h6{	font-size:1em;	font-weight:bold	}h1 img,h2 img,h3 img,h4 img,h5 img,h6 img{margin:0}p{	font-size:1em;	line-height:1.5;	color:#666;	margin:0 0 1.5em;	line-height:1.5em	}a{	color:#948250;	background:#fefefe;	padding:.2em;	text-decoration:underline;	font-style:italic;	-moz-border-radius:3px;	-khtml-border-radius:3px;	-webkit-border-radius:3px;	border-radius:3px	}/* a:hover{	color:#C8C08F;	text-decoration:underline	} */	a:focus,a:hover{color:#765D1A}a{color:#765D1A;text-decoration:underline;outline:none}em{font-style:italic}strong{font-weight:bold}tt,code,pre{	font:.9em 'andale mono','lucida console',monospace;	line-height:1.5	}pre{	padding:3em;	background:#FEFEFE;	border:1px solid #ddd;	width:auto;	height:auto;	overflow:scroll;	margin-bottom:3em;	color:#555;	-moz-border-radius:3px;	-khtml-border-radius:3px;	-webkit-border-radius:3px;	border-radius:3px	}li ul,li ol{margin:0 1.5em}ul,ol{margin:0 1.5em 1.5em 1.5em}ul{list-style-type:disc}ol{list-style-type:decimal}blockquote{	font-size:.8em;	margin:1em 0 2em 0;	padding:4em;	color:#666;	background:#fefefe;	border-left: 2px solid #ddd;	/* text-shadow: #eee 2px 2px 0px */	}hr{	background:#999;	color:#999;	clear:both;	float:none;	width:100%;	height:1px;	margin:0 0 1.45em;	border:none	}::-moz-selection{	background:#000;	color:#fff	}::selection{	background:#000;	color:#fff	}pre::-moz-selection{	background:#000;	color:#fff	}pre::selection{	background:#000;	color:#fff	}img{	width:auto;	height:auto	}	/* recurrent classes */.small{font-size:.8em; margin-bottom:1.875em; line-height:1.875em}.large{font-size:1.2em;}.hide{display:none}.center{text-align:center}.right{text-align:right}.noimage img{display:none}.italic{font-style:italic}.padding1{padding:1em}.padding2{padding:2em}.padding3{padding:3em}.padding-half{padding:.75em}.space{width:100%;height:3em;clear:both}/* grid - ccs defaults - */.module100{width:100%;float:left}.module66{width:66%;float:left}.module33{width:33%;float:left}.module34{width:34%;float:left}.module50{width:50%;float:left}.module60{width:60%;float:left}.module40{width:40%;float:left}.module75{width:75%;float:left;}.module70{width:70%;float:left;}.module25{width:25%;float:left;}.module30{width:30%;float:left;}.module20{width:20%;float:left;}.module80{width:80%;float:left;}/*start site's specific styles*/body{	font-size:100%;	background:#f8f8f8	}.container{	width:668px;	margin:0 auto;	}.container2{	width:668px;	margin:0 auto	}#top-pages{	width:100%;	height:auto;	float:left;	font-size:small;	margin:0 auto;	background:#fff	}#top-pages li{	list-style-type:none;	display:inline;	margin-right:1em;	padding:.2em;	background:#eee;	-moz-border-radius:3px;	-khtml-border-radius:3px;	-webkit-border-radius:3px;	border-radius:3px;	position:relative;top:1em	}#top-pages li:hover{	background:#ddd;	}#top-pages a{color:#999}#top-pages a:hover{	text-decoration:none;	color:#555	}#header{	width:100%;	height:119px;/*172*/	/* line-height:144px; */	background:#fff	}#logo{	position:relative;	top:53px;	}#title{	margin-top:53px;	text-align:right	}#body{margin-top:1em}#sidebar{width:288px}#sidebar p{	width:144px;	font-size:.8em;	color:#555;	font-family: 'bauer bodoni LT', bodoni, cambria, georgia, serif;	}#sidebar img{/*	padding:10px;	border:1px solid #ddd;	background:#fff*/	}#sidebar h5{	margin-bottom:0em;	font-size: 80%;	}#articles{	color:#444;/*	position:relative;left:6em;*/	font-family: calibri, arial;	font-size: 85%;	width: 380px;	}#articles h5{	font-family: calibri, arial;	font-weight:bold;	color:#765D1A;	margin-bottom:0em;	}#the-titles{	border-top:2px solid #ddd;	border-bottom:2px dotted #ddd;	min-height:3em;	margin-bottom:1.5em	}#the-titles h3{	margin-top:.5em;	margin-bottom:0	}#the-titles p{	margin-top:1.3em;	margin-bottom:0	}.meta{	width:120px;	position:absolute;	right:-144px;	padding:.5em;	font-size:.65em;	background:#eee;	-moz-border-radius:6px;	-khtml-border-radius:6px;	-webkit-border-radius:6px;	border-radius:6px;	}	.little-info li{	line-height:1.2em;	list-style-type:none;	padding-top:1em	}	.tags-and-cats li{	list-style-type:none;	padding:0 .2em;	margin-bottom:5px;	background:#fefefe;	-moz-border-radius:3px;	-khtml-border-radius:3px;	-webkit-border-radius:3px;	border-radius:3px;	}
